Knocked out a few minor things this week:

-Replaced radius arm bushings, found out both radius arm shoulders are rusting away. Still trying to decide if I'll replace them with stock radius arms, or throw in a 2.5" lift with extended arms.

-Oil change, greased front end and u-joints.

-New header gaskets. Went with Fel-Pro this time, after reading about Evan's issues with Percy's gaskets, I was hesitant to install the set I've had for a year now. (thanks Evan)

-Removed AIR pump, which I had bypassed a year ago, along with the rest of the AIR system.

-Replaced serp belt tensioner.

-Bumped timing up to 14 deg BTDC.

-Had a set of new-to-me Michelin LTX A/S2 tires mounted and balanced, along with having the tire shop set toe. I replaced tie rods a few weeks ago, and lined it up quick with a tape measure. As fate would have it, 285/70/17s fit just fine, no rubbing. :) Reset the PSOM also, so the speedo is correct.


Still need to do pivot bushings, and decide what to do as far as radius arms go... suggestions are gladly accepted and appreciated.

Disabled the power door lock in the driver door (love the smoothness and ease of the lock mechanism now). I also pulled the parking brake pedal/release mechanism. The ratcheting catch was stuck open not allowing the brake to be set. It needed wd40, some movement and then oiling....should be good for another 24 years and I can now park on a hill!!!
